On August 19, 1991, George H. W. Bush was woken up just after midnight to be told that Mikhail Gorbachev had resigned suddenly for health reasons as the President of the Soviet Union. That did not sound right to anyone.
What unfolded for the next three days was the entire world watching the unraveling of one of the two Super Powers of the past half century. Gorbachev was placed under house arrest in his Black Sea Dacha, and his vice President and the leaders of the KGB and the Army took over the country.
However, the coup was poorly conceived, poorly managed, and the plotters were often unwilling to to the things necessary to secure control of the country. They also miscalculated how much the reforms that Gorbachev had set forward in the Soviet Union had actually taken hold. The people were resisting the take over and a leader emerged who stood up against it all.
His name was Boris Yeltsin. This is the story of those three days in the next three episodes. It was a historic three days that changed the World.
